Aza-macrocycloalkanes and their derivatives are a sort of new ligands with excellent performance. Now, they are widely used in medical treatment, biological medicine, and other realms with bright future. However, over decades, there is barely a laboratory method which could handle with simple operations, facile materials, and high yields.In order to synthesis aza-macrocycloalkanes efficiently and conveniently, this research combined the existing Richman-Atkins Method and its improvements, summarized a route with diethylenetriamine, ethylenediamine, triethylenetetramine and diethanolamine as starting materials, via tosylation, cyclisation, detosylation, methylation and oxidation procedures, synthesized cyclen, TACN and PACP, and their methylated derivatives, oxidized methylated derivatives, and the condensed product of glyoxal and cyclen. Characterized them by melting point, IR, and 1H-NMR. In these compounds, the oxidized methylated derivatives were first synthesized, had not been reported. Compared with literature, cyclisation and detosylation were general and creative ones with higher yields in this route. Meanwhile, several coordination compounds were prepared with those ligands, and three benzo-macrocyclic sulfonamides were synthesized. In the end, two compounds were selected for the preliminary catalytic activity test.
